Core class used to manage meta values for terms via the REST API. Feb 23, 2016 · Now, when clicking the Add Image button the WordPress media uploader will launch and allow you to select an image. It’ll grab the ID of the selected image and insert that into the hidden field with the ID category-image-id. This is the field that we’ll actually save. In order to present the image to the user, we use some jQuery to populate ... May 3, 2016 · A data schema for meta. register_meta () is a tiny function, which lets you register a sanitization and authorization callback for post meta, term meta, user meta or comment meta. We’re going to expand the utility of this function to describe the data type of the field. This will be useful for the REST API as well as the Fields API. When you change anything (f.e. url slug or name) on category list admin page the custom field value changes to empty string.But OR logic is applied within the various ‘s’ fields searched. The ‘s’ search term and ‘meta_query’ search terms don’t have to be the same, but could be. WP_Query does not have an option to specify OR logic between ‘s’ and ‘meta_query’. Retrieves the type for register_rest_field() in the context of comments. WP_Meta_Query is a class defined in wp-includes/meta.php that generates the necessary SQL for meta-related queries. It was introduced in Version 3.2.0 and greatly improved the possibility to query posts by custom fields. In the WP core, it’s used in the WP_Query and WP_User_Query classes, and since Version 3.5 in the WP_Comment_Query class. Description. WordPress offers filter hooks to allow plugins to modify various types of internal data at runtime. A plugin can modify data by binding a callback to a filter hook. When the filter is later applied, each bound callback is run in order of priority, and given the opportunity to modify a value by returning a new value. .
